Story summary
- In March 2026, records show Portland Police Bureau and South Portland Police Department communicated with federal agents during January 2026 immigration enforcement surge.
- Text messages show police monitored protests and protected agents, despite claims they did not collaborate with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E).
- ACLU of Maine is suing Sanford, Maine, over records on traffic stops tied to ICE detentions.
- Advocates warn federal operations continue affecting immigrant communities in Maine.
